13 monuments destroyed at the Serbian cemetery in Vukovar

In the Croatian city of Vukovar, which in 1991 was the scene of bloody battles between Serbs and Croats, 13 monuments in the Serbian Orthodox cemetery were destroyed. The Serbian Orthodox Church (SOC) reported this on January 12, a PolitNavigator correspondent reports. This happened during the Christmas holidays. Croatian authorities decided that the once Serbian Vukovar is not ripe for the Cyrillic alphabet

The Vukovar City Council agreed with the conclusions of the local mayor, nationalist Ivan Penava, that the city has not created the conditions for the return of the Cyrillic alphabet.
